Binny's Home Bartender: Death in the Afternoon

Don't be frightened by the name. Esteemed American author, Ernest Hemingway invented this cocktail and named it after his 1935 novel, Death in the Afternoon. It's definitely a powerful drink, but you will love it. Mardi Gras goers substitute mimosas for this iconic cocktail.

Confessions of a Mixologist: Kir Germain

Everyone knows the classic cocktail Kir. It's a mix of sparkling wine and raspberry liquor such as Chambord. Use Champagne and you have a Kir Royale. We are taking it a step further with the inclusion of one of our favorite herbal liquors, St. Germain Elderflower.
